Testo completo'mixed music' describes a form of music which combines an instrumental and or vocal score with pre-set taped sounds. It first appeared in the early 1950's and led to an enormous amount of experimental work by individual composers (alvarez, harvey, holler, mache, malec, nono, risset, stockhausen, stroppa, vaggione, vinao. . . ), with the application of recent technological advances to music, different types of musical production have merged into the concept of 'contemporary music'. We can now look at the development of mixed music by dividing it into three categories 'lives electronic music'. Real-time's electronic music and mixed music. A study of the mixed music repertoire shows a style of composition evolving gradually round the concept of fusing and opposing the two worlds of instrumental and elctronic music. Together they form an aesthetic entity, while creating an impression of double, hybrid, illusion and ambiguity. . . Plan : history, aesthetics and repertoire of mixed music

Testo completoThis research aims to analyze and to comprehend the role of no human agents in the mixtec genealogical, historical, and cosmological narratives produced in the late pre-hispanic and early colonial period, more precisely those characters considered as deities by the specialists in the study of these manuscripts. To achieve this objective, the supposed deities and their actions will be analyzed in four mixtec codices: Bodley, Selden, Vindobonense and Zouche Nuttall, pictoglyphic manuscripts produced at behest of mixtec indigenous elites. The agents involved in these histories could be the basis to comprehend what would be the conceptions of history and political power to these elites, since the production of the narratives encloused in the mesoamerican codices were closely linked to the influence and justification of political domain of the indigenous elites.

Testo completoHis research deals with the behaviour and design of piled raft foundations, when these make use of the combined actions of both the raft and the piles to carry the loads of the structure. The first part of the thesis is devoted to vertical loading. A literature review on the development of piled-raft foundations since the 1970's is presented (chapter I). The main aspects of the foundation behaviour are discussed through case histories of different types of structures, including buildings and bridges, in France and in other countries. Issues related to the determination of the ultimate bearing capacity (chapter II) and settlements (chapter III) are addressed through a comparison of design methods and real field data. The results of a full-scale static loading test, performed specifically for this project, are analysed (chapter IV). The test was carried out on an instrumented pile, driven in stiff Flandrian clay and capped with a footing. In the second part, a practical design method is proposed for the piled-raft system under horizontal loading (chapter V). This method is applied to several full-scale tests : instrumented pile groups, carried at Bucknell University in the United States, and the foundation of a small dam located in the Mont-Saint-Michel Bay in France (chapter VI). The third part of the thesis is devoted to foundations subjected to overturning moments. Results of a full-scale static loading test, carried out during this research, on the foundations of a noise barrier, are analysed. This foundation was made of two instrumented micropiles connected by a rigid cap resting directly on the ground (chapter VII). Issues related to the actual behaviour of the foundation are examined, with particular attention to the assessment of displacements, which are of prime importance for the design of this type of structure (chapter VIII)

Testo completoIn France, in 2014, health expenditures represented EUR 190 billion. This figure grows year after year; 76.6% is financed by a compulsory social insurance (Assurance Maladie), with contributions proportional to income; 13.5% is financed by private complementary insurances and 8.5% is financed directly by households in the form of out-of-pockets. The relationship between Social Health Insurance (SHI) and Private Health Insurance (PHI) is what characterises a mixed system.Within mixed systems, insurances can complement each other but also interact in inefficient ways. In a first part, I study a system where SHI can be complemented by a complementary or supplementary private insurance. Whereas there was a confusion in the theoretical literature between complementary and supplementary insurances, we find that these insurances can have opposing effects. This model underlines the importance of the nature of the health good (in terms of elasticity) insured by SHI on the optimal rate of social insurance. The higher the rate of low income individual purchasing the socially insured good, the higher the redistributive effect of insurance will be. Marginal utility of poor individuals being higher than high income individuals, I find that using an unweighted additive welfare function, the optimal social insurance rate of insurance is positively related to the redistributive characteristic of insurance.In this first part we underline that the selection of goods that should be insured privately depends on the definition of social insurance. The second part studies what criteria should be used to select the goods to socially insure. At the heart of the selection of goods to socially insure is the possibility of comparing individual preferences debated extensively within welfare economics and formalised by Arrow’s incompatibility theorem. The equivalent income principal developed by Fleurbaey et al. (2013) offers to overcome this limitation. This ordinal criteria, defined as the income in perfect health which yields the same satisfaction as the income in a sick state (i.e. the income in good health minus the willingness to pay to be in good health), allows making interpersonal comparisons. By adapting a theoretical model studying the optimal selection of goods to insure socially (Hoel, 2007) and by using the equivalent income criteria, we find that the introduction of private health insurance decreases the marginal benefit of social insurance. This modifies the ranking function and decreases the optimal social budget, leaving uninsured individuals facing the impossibility to use certain efficient treatments.Whereas the second part revealed what treatment social insurance should first renounce reimbursing in a within a limited budget, the last chapter studies a market characterised by minimal social participation. The market of eyewear (glasses) is characterised by strong asymmetric information and product differentiation. Beyond financing health expenditures, we ask whether, similarly to social insurance, PHI are able to reduce the effects of market failures and manage health expenditures. Following the literature on managed-care and competition for the right to serve a demand, the effect of networks of preferred provides on prices is analysed. Using an exclusive dataset of all purchases in eyewear made by MGEN (Mutuelle Générale de l’Education Nationale) enrollees between 2012 and 2014, we test empirically the effect of the network on the number of purchases and the prices of lenses. The effect of competition for the network and in the market on prices of unifocal and bifocal lenses, within 450 areas of France, is estimated. We find that competition for the network reduces significantly prices of purchases made inside the network and competition in the market reduces prices outside the network

Testo completoRecent advances in modern construction have led to the systematic use of combined concrete slab and timber beams as a horizontal load bearing structural component, the latter playing an identical role as steel beams in a composite concrete steel floor. Unfortunately the well-established rules governing the design of shear connectors for structural composite concrete-steel floors cannot be applied directly to wood-concrete composite structural elements due to the nature of the bond that exists between wood and connecting elements. Thus the thesis was aimed at investigating the mechanical behavior of two types of shear connector using static tests. They consisted of a dowel-type connector with a metal base plate and a tubular connector. Using a shear test rig preliminary lateral and axial resistance of different nails, screws with and without disc springs as well as punched metal plates were investigated. These were compared with Eurocode 4 recommendations and the observations led to the design and testing of standardized pushout specimens for both connector types according to the provisions of Eurocode 4. Two predictive techniques were developed to account for the serviceability limit state as well as the ultimate resistance of the connectors. For the former, an elastic model was used to predict the load-deformation characteristics of the dowel through an exact stiffness formulation of a beam on elastic foundation. While the ultimate resistance was based on a modified Johansen yield model. Comparisons between the theoretical and experimental results were found to be in good agreement

Testo completoAmericium isotopes represent a significant part of high-level and long-lived nuclear waste in spent fuels. Among the envisaged reprocessing scenarios, their transmutation in fast neutron reactors using uranium-americium mixed-oxide pellets (U1-xAmxO2±δ) is a promising option which would help decrease the ecological footprint of ultimate waste repository sites. In this context, this thesis is dedicated to the study of such compounds over a wide range of americium contents (7.5 at.% ≤ Am/(U+Am) ≤ 70 at.%), with an emphasis on their fabrication from single-oxide precursors and the assessment of their structural and thermodynamic stabilities, also taking self-irradiation effects into account. Results highlight the main influence of americium reduction to Am+III, not only on the mechanisms of solid-state formation of the U1-xAmxO2±δ solid solution, but also on the stabilization of oxidized uranium cations and the formation of defects in the oxygen sublattice such as vacancies and cuboctahedral clusters. In addition, the data acquired concerning the stability of U1-xAmxO2±δ compounds (existence of a miscibility gap, vaporization behavior) were compared to calculations based on new thermodynamic modelling of the U-Am-O ternary system. Finally, α-self-irradiation-induced structural effects on U1-xAmxO2±δ compounds were analyzed using XRD, XAS and TEM, allowing the influence of americium content on the structural swelling to be studied as well as the description of the evolution of radiation-induced structural defects

Testo completoIn order to improve nuclear energy industry sustainability, future research needs to focus on the use of co-management of actinides and their co-conversion. The synthesis of uranium/plutonium mixed oxide by oxalic approach is currently the preferred method. Nevertheless the use of mixed peroxides, like precursors of mixed oxides, is considered as an alternative pathway.In fact, the recent advances on several uranyl peroxides or pero-oxalates nano-clusters stabilized by mono-, di- or tri-valent cations has permitted to investigate the formation of mixed peroxides. This study aims to investigate the formation of mixed uranium (VI) and lanthanide (III) peroxides leading to the formation of uranium-lanthanide mixed oxides, by heat treatment. Lanthanide (III) are used as actinides (III) analogs. The study of the UO22+/NH4+/O22-/C2O42- system allowed us to (i) refine the domains of existence of uranyl and ammonium peroxide and peroxo-oxalates as a function of reactive concentrations or pH (ii) obtain twelve news crystalline phases. At pH 9 and above, amorphous phases precipitated and after neodymium (III) exchange and calcination, led to the formation of mixed oxides. Mixed oxides can thus incorporate from 20 to 30% of neodymium. Finally the use of non thermically labile cations permits the formation of new U-Ca or U-Rb phases

Testo completoIn this work, the preparation of chitosan-coated alginate fibers by a wet spin process and the characterization of these fibers, particularly their antibacterial activities are presented. A pilot scale spinning machine was developed during this thesis for the elaboration of calcium alginate fibers. These last, preformed produced were immersed in chitosan acetate solutions. Three coagulation methods of the chitosan coating were explored two of which consist to the immersion of the fibers in a neutralizing bath: a calcium hydroxide solution or a potassium hydroxide solution. The last method is to neutralize chitosan by drying under hot air blown. Structural, mechanical and absorption characterization of fibers and a dose of the coated chitosan have been made. Furthermore, the antibacterial evaluation was achieved by a CFU (Colony-Forming Units) counting method after 6 h of incubation at 37 °C. The incorporation of chitosan on calcium alginate fibers brings antibacterial activities against Staphylococcus epidermidis, Escherichia coli and various Staphylococcus aureus strains namely MSSA (Methicillin Sensitive Staphylococcus aureus), CA-MRSA (Community Associated Methicillin Resistant Staphylococcus aureus) and HA-MRSA (Healthcare Associated Methicillin Resistant Staphylococcus aureus) which make these chitosan-coated fibers potential candidates for wound dressing materials. Developing a wound dressing with the haemostatic and healing properties of alginate combined with antibacterial properties of chitosan can be envisioned for fighting against the infections and more particularly nosocomial infections

Testo completoThe Molten Salt Oxidation (MSO) technique has been studied in recent years for the treatment, valorization, or destruction of waste. This process has been extensively studied with molten carbonates or chlorides for the destruction of hazardous waste or the recovery of metals. In the context of our research on the treatment of waste from the nuclear industry, the process has been adapted for the treatment of mixed contaminated waste (a mixture of waste of different natures, polymers, glasses, metals) in molten hydroxides. Thus, in this manuscript, a first chapter details the state of the art of molten salts and their uses in pyrochemical treatment, with a section specifically dedicated to the chemistry of molten hydroxides and their potential applications in the treatment of organic waste. The second chapter presents the design and implementation of a dedicated setup for the study of polymer degradation in these salts, as well as the development of a specific reference electrode for molten hydroxides allowing the study of these baths by electrochemistry. Finally, the third chapter focuses on polymer degradation, demonstrating the mechanisms involved in the degradation of organic compounds. It is shown that these mechanisms do not correspond to the expected oxidation mechanism during the "classic" MSO process in molten carbonates. Those involved in our process are of a radical type, following a process of cracking of organic materials which induces the production of highly valuable dihydrogen and graphite carbon. Last chapter presents the monitoring, by electrochemistry as well as by XRD and EPR, of the reactivity of cerium and neodymium lanthanides in our baths, chosen as simulants of actinides

Testo completoThe growing complexity of modern chips poses challenging test problems due to the requirement for specialized test equipment and the involved lengthy test times. This is particularly true for heterogeneous chips that comprise digital, analogue, and RF blocks onto the same substrate. Many research efforts are currently under way in the mixed-signal test domain. Theses efforts concern optimization of tests at the production stage (e. G. Off-line) or during the lifetime of the chip (on-line test). A promising research direction is the integration of additional circuitry on-chip, aiming to facilitate the test application (Design For Test) and/or to perform Built-In-Self-Test. The efficiency of such test techniques, both in terms of test accuracy and test cost, must be assessed during the design stage. However, there is an alarming lack of CAT tools, which are necessary, in order to facilitate the study of these techniques and, thereby, expedite their transfer into a production setting. In this thesis, we develop a CAT platform that can be used for the validation of analogue test techniques. The platform includes tools for fault modeling, injection and simulation, as well as tools for analogue test vector generation and optimization. A new statistical method is proposed and integrated into the platform, in order to assess the quality of test techniques during the design stage. This method aims to set the limits of the considered test criteria. Then, the different test metrics (as Fault coverage, Defect level or Yield loss) are evaluated under the presence of parametric and catastrophic faults. Some specific tests can be added to improve the structural fault coverage. The CAT platform is integrated in the Cadence design framework environment
